实战:用注意力机制构建文本分类模型
1
0
0
0
在自然语言处理领域,文本分类是一个基础且重要的任务。本文将实战讲解如何使用注意力机制构建文本分类模型,从数据预处理到模型训练,再到性能评估,全面解析整个流程。
1. 数据预处理
在进行文本分类之前,我们需要对文本数据进行预处理。这包括去除停用词、词干提取、分词等步骤。为了提高模型的性能,我们还可以对文本进行词嵌入,将文本转换为向量形式。
2. 模型构建
本文将使用PyTorch框架构建一个基于注意力机制的文本分类模型。模型的核心是注意力层,它能够捕捉文本中的重要信息。
3. 模型训练
在构建好模型后,我们需要使用标注好的数据集进行训练。训练过程中,我们需要调整模型参数,以使模型能够更好地拟合数据。
4. 性能评估
模型训练完成后,我们需要对模型进行性能评估。常用的评估指标包括准确率、召回率、F1值等。
5. 实战案例
最后,我们将通过一个实际案例展示如何使用注意力机制进行文本分类。
通过本文的实战讲解,相信读者能够对使用注意力机制构建文本分类模型有一个全面的理解。